    After spending numerous hours in the first 4 days of play, I have discovered that the only way to advance with any efficiency is to spend real dollars. The conquering of the first available valley should be easier, or at least guided somewhat so a new player does not lose all of his or her troops. After three attempts to gain new land, I lost more than 90% of my workers, pikesmen, swordsmen, and archers, and began running low on gold and other resources. Making play for new players a bit easier might keep them engaged long enough to value the time invested in the game, time that may cause a player to be more willing to spend real money. The free play given at this point did not provide enough interest to keep me engaged to the point where I was willing to rebuild by spending cash on "game coins".

    The game does have serious potential, but I'm not wasting any more time or money.

    What I find to be more interesting is that in 4 days he wasn't able to conquer a valley. What level valley are you going after, a lvl 10? At that point you should be looking at lvl 1-3 valleys, nothing higher.

    Take your time. Let your resources build. You must be tring to take a valley that is way to high for you, right now. Start with level 1 and 2's , no higher. Follow the quest guide.
